Q: What should I do if Vaultspin reports a partial rotation during my on-call shift?

A: Do not retry immediately. A partial rotation means some consumers still hold the old secret, and a blind retry can invalidate both versions. Confirm which consumers acknowledged the new value, then run the reconcile step. The full recovery procedure is on the page below.

operations page: https://jenkins.zemvarcloud.local/job/merge_requests/repo/build/73930b4b30f0a8ed

### Autocomplete index latency

The Wrenmoor suggest index degrades past 500k entries because prefix scans bypass the bloom layer. We shard by first two characters and cap scan depth. Future maintainers: resist widening the scan cap; it masks shard imbalance. Rebalance instead. Shard count, scan depth, and cache sizing are fixed by the constants below.

limits module of fajog-tawig:
RATE_LIMITS = {
    "druwyn": 2,
    "quenael": 10,
    "wenix": 2,
    "druael": 2,
}

## Kioskwatch Watchdog — Restart Procedure

Every Lumenboard kiosk runs the Kioskwatch watchdog, which restarts the display app if the heartbeat file isn't touched for 45 seconds. If a kiosk is cycling repeatedly, the watchdog is usually fine — check the app logs first. To adjust thresholds, edit the watchdog config on the device and restart the service; changes take effect immediately, no reboot needed. Don't disable the watchdog on customer sites without approval from the Halverton ops lead. The default configuration is shown below.

service settings:
[casax]
port = 6379
team = rusir
host = casax.zemvarhq.corp
region = outer-4
access_code = ac_9808ce
timeout_ms = 1500

Welcome to Gridloom, Pellworth Studio's crossword generator. Clone the repo, run make seed to pull the word lists, then make grid for a sample puzzle. Solver heuristics live in fill/; don't touch scoring weights without a benchmark run. CI blocks merges under 95% fill rate. Wordlist updates are signed; the signing vault unlocks with the recovery passphrase printed below.

vault phrase of fahog-yajof = istael-zorwyn